Record number of cruise ships in Wellington

12:14 pm on 19 April 2011

A record number of cruise ships have visited Wellington during summer, contributing about $20 million to the region's economy.

Sixty cruise ships docked during the season, which runs between October and April, bringing a total of 125,000 passengers to Wellington.

CentrePort expects the next season to be even bigger, with 80 ships booked to call at the port, including several coinciding with the Rugby World Cup.

Chief Executive Blair O'Keeffe says that would mean an estimated $31 million injection into the economy.

Cruise ship visits to Wellington have increased by 74% in the past two years.
